Understanding CO2 Laser Treatment
CO2 laser treatment involves the use of carbon dioxide laser beams to remove layers of skin tissue at precise levels. This process stimulates the production of new collagen and skin cells, leading to smoother, more youthful skin. It is particularly effective for treating wrinkles, scars, and other skin imperfections. However, the effectiveness and appropriateness of this treatment can vary significantly with age.

Benefits of Treatment in Different Age Groups
1. **Young Adults (20s-30s):** In this age group, CO2 laser treatment can effectively address early signs of aging and prevent more significant skin damage. It is also beneficial for those with acne scars or uneven skin texture.
2. **Middle-Aged Adults (40s-50s):** As the skin naturally loses collagen and elasticity, CO2 laser can significantly reduce wrinkles, deeper scars, and pigmentation issues. This age group often sees the most dramatic improvements from the treatment.
3. **Older Adults (60s and above):** While still effective, the recovery process might be longer in older adults due to reduced skin regeneration capabilities. However, CO2 laser can still provide noticeable improvements in skin texture and appearance.

Recovery and Aftercare
The recovery period for CO2 laser treatment can vary depending on the individual's age and skin condition. Generally, younger patients tend to recover faster due to their higher collagen production and skin regeneration capabilities. Proper aftercare, including sun protection and moisturizing, is crucial to ensure optimal results and minimize the risk of complications.

Q: Is CO2 laser treatment painful?
A: Most patients experience some discomfort during the treatment, which can be managed with topical anesthetics. The recovery period may also involve some mild to moderate discomfort, which can be alleviated with prescribed medications.
Q: How long do the results of CO2 laser treatment last?
A: The longevity of results can vary, but typically, improvements can last several years. Regular maintenance treatments may be recommended to sustain the benefits.
Q: Are there any risks associated with CO2 laser treatment?
A: As with any medical procedure, there are potential risks, including infection, scarring, and changes in skin pigmentation. However, these risks are minimized with proper patient selection and expert administration of the treatment.
